EAST FISHKILL - June A. Martin, 85, a lifelong area resident, died on December 17, 2016 at her daughter's home.

Born in the Bronx on May 24, 1931, she was the daughter of Archer and Frieda Geisler Starrett. June had been employed by the Wappingers Central School District until her retirement in 1995. She also sold Avon for over 50 years, often delivering it on horseback. She was a member of the Hopewell Reformed Church and a life member of the Hillside Lake Fire Company. Lovingly know as the "Neighborhood Grandmom", she was also a 4H, Girl Scout and Cub Scout Leader, and drove stock cars in the Powder Puff Derby.

On May 25, 1950 in Boston, MA, June married the love of her life, Willard G. Martin. He predeceased her on February 27, 2014. She is survived by her daughters, Cindy Kohlmaier and husband Heinz of Pine Plains, Ann Secor and husband Jim of Hillside Lake, and Sharon Higham of Hopewell Junction; her grandchildren, Kelly, Brenden, Amber, Trisa and Lena; her great-grandchildren, Luke, J.C., Aiden, Ava, Cade and Riley; her sister, Barbara Armstrong; her sisters-in-law, Shirley McCaffery and Doris Martin; her extended family, Doug Ziegler, the Metzger Family and Lisa Barach; her dog, Midnight; and many nieces (with special thanks to Beth and Tanya Dykeman), nephews, great-nieces, great-nephews and friends. June was also predeceased by her son, Billy Martin; her grandsons, Jimmy Secor Jr. and Kevin Higham; and her nephews, Keith McCaffery and Chris Hargrave.
